Description Jim Cornette 2006-11-03 16:45:39 UTC
Description of problem:
When attempting to install a new system with a SIS630 integrated video, 
anaconda bombs out. If specifying xdriver=sis during installation the 
installation is successful.

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):
FC6 released version.

How reproducible:
Just press enter at the boot: screen of the installer.

Steps to Reproduce:
1. Allow system to start.
2. get mini-wm error
3. reboot
4. Specify 'linux xdriver=sis' at the boot: prompt
5. Install the system successfully via the GUI 
  
Actual results:

Not specifying the driver caused failure. Manually specifying the driver 
allowed successful installation.

Expected results:

Not needing to specifically tell anaconda that I had a particular video 
chipset.
